同样带宽杭州和北京的访问速度一样吗?

结论是:同样带宽的情况下,杭州和北京的访问速度不一定一样。影响两地访问速度的因素众多,涉及网络架构、物理距离、中间节点质量、服务器位置、ISP服务质量等多方面因素。

首先,从物理距离上看,杭州与北京相距约1200公里左右。根据光信号在光纤中的传播速度(大约为2/3光速),即使不考虑任何其他延迟因素,单程传输时间也需要大约10毫秒。这使得跨城市的数据传输必然存在一定的基础延迟。

其次,网络架构对访问速度也有显著影响。我国的互联网骨干网主要由几大运营商构建,不同地区之间的互联节点数量和质量差异较大。例如,东部沿海发达地区通常拥有更多的直连线路和更高的带宽资源,而内陆地区的连接可能需要经过多个跳转节点才能到达目标位置。因此,从杭州到北京的数据包可能会经过更多复杂的路由选择,增加了传输延迟。

再者,服务器的位置也会影响访问速度。如果用户请求的内容存储在北京本地的数据中心内,那么无论是在杭州还是北京发起请求,只要两者都处于同一运营商网络或优质CDN覆盖范围内,理论上可以获得相似的速度体验。但如果内容源位于其他地方,则需考虑该地到北京或杭州之间的链路状况,以及是否存在有效的缓存机制来提速响应时间。

另外,Internet Service Provider (ISP) 的服务质量也是关键因素之一。不同的ISP在网络建设和维护水平上存在差异,部分地区可能存在拥塞现象或者优化不足的问题,导致即使是相同带宽条件下,实际可用带宽和稳定性的表现也会有所不同。比如,在高峰时段,某些ISP可能出现流量过载的情况,从而降低整体访问速度。

最后,还需要考虑到应用层协议本身带来的开销。HTTP/HTTPS等协议在建立连接时会产生额外的握手过程,这部分时间消耗与地理位置无关,但会叠加在总的访问延迟之上。

综上所述,虽然杭州和北京两地具备相同的带宽条件,但由于上述多种因素的存在,它们之间的访问速度并不一定完全相同。对于追求高效稳定的网络服务而言,除了关注带宽指标外,还应该综合考量以上提到的各项因素,并尽可能选择靠近目标区域的服务提供商及数据中心,以确保最佳的用户体验。